It wasn’t long after I booked my first Disney Cruise that I started hearing a lot of excited chatter about “Fish Extenders.” I did what any curious person would do, and turned to google to see exactly what it was all about. 

Essentially, you sign-up for a Fish Extender Group through Facebook. There are usually 10 cabins per group. You give a small gift to each member in your group. Gifts can be really be anything, whether it’s homemade or purchased. Completely your call.

To customize them, you can either hand write your names and cabin number…OR, you can easily upload the image to a photo editing site (I use picmonkey). Then add text. The font I used is Newport Classic SG.  Then you can simply print them out on cardstock, and trim with a paper trimmer. Super easy!!

Other than Fish Extender Groups, sometimes people will leave random “pixie-dust” inside of your Fish Extender. While this is not something everyone chooses to do, I happened to have a few extras and I thought it would be fun to share with other travelers! For this, I created a “Pixie-Dust” Tag!
